Figure 6

Cnot3 plays a critical role in cardiomyocyte proliferation in vivo. (a) Western blots to show Cnot3 protein level in developing hearts from mouse embryos at indicated time points. β-actin was used as loading control. The blots were cropped since different antibodies were incubated at the same time. (b) Western blot to show Cnot3 protein level in mouse neonatal hearts versus adult hearts. β-actin was used as loading control. The blots were cropped since different antibodies were incubated at the same time. (c) Representative images of immunofluorescence or immunochemical staining against Ki67 to show the impact of Cnot3 overexpression on cardiomyocyte proliferation in a mouse myocardial infarction model (See experimental procedures for details). DAPI (blue) was used to stain the cell nuclei. Magnification: 100x. (d) Statistical analysis of (C). Ki67+TnnT2+ cells were counted from 10 sections per mouse, 6 mice per group, values were plotted as mean ± SEM from three independent experiments, *p < 0.05. (e) Representative images of echo to show heart functions in GFP overexpression or Cnot3 overexpression hearts at indicated time points, respectively. (f) Statistical analysis of (e). Values were calculated as fractional shortening, and plotted as mean ± SEM. n = 6 per group, *p < 0.05.
